Gene expression Investigation disclosed that ACKR3 is extremely expressed in numerous brain areas akin to important opioid action centers. In addition, its expression stages are frequently higher than These of classical opioid receptors, which more supports the physiological relevance of its noticed in vitro opioid peptide scavenging potential.

We shown that, in distinction to classical opioid receptors, ACKR3 will not set off classical G protein signaling and is not modulated with the classical prescription or conolidine analgesic opioids, for instance morphine, fentanyl, or buprenorphine, or by nonselective opioid antagonists for example naloxone. As an alternative, we set up that LIH383, an ACKR3-selective subnanomolar competitor peptide, prevents ACKR3’s negative regulatory perform on opioid peptides in an ex vivo rat Mind design and potentiates their activity towards classical opioid receptors.
